Week 11 foes San Benito, Harlingen High remain atop Top 10 high school fooyball poll

RGVSPORTS.COM

It’s only right that the top two teams in RGVSports.com’s Week 11 Top 10 high school football poll meet up the last week of the regular season to determine a district champion.

That’s the case with unanimous No. 1 San Benito and No. 2 Harlingen High. The two longtime rivals square up Friday to determine the winner of the District 32-6A crown.

San Benito remained RGVSports.com’s No. 1 team for the ninth straight week after beating Weslaco High 27-7 last week. The Greyhounds are 9-0 and were voted No. 1 by all of RGVSports.com’s seven voters who cover RGV high school football for AIM Media’s three newspapers (the Monitor, Valley Morning Star and Brownsville Herald).

Harlingen High is 7-2 and winner of six consecutive games. The Cardinals beat Brownsville Hanna 31-14 last week.

Nos. 3 and 4 in the poll stayed the same. Edinburg Vela, at 8-1, is No. 3 and coming off a 64-40 win over PSJA High. The SaberCats play Edinburg Economedes on Friday and can clinch the outright District 31-6A title with a win.

District 30-6A champ McAllen Memorial is No. 4. The Mustangs are 7-2 after dominating La Joya Juarez-Lincoln 59-7 last week. McAllen Memorial closes its regular season by playing McAllen Rowe on Friday.

Sharyland Pioneer moved up a spot to No. 5. The Diamondbacks are 7-2 and clinched a playoff berth for the first time in the school’s three years with a 33-3 rout of Laredo Martin last week.

Pioneer is in line to earn at least a share of the District 31-5A title when it hosts Roma on Friday.

Weslaco East is up two spots to No. 6. The Wildcats are 5-4 and coming off an impressive 28-7 win over Harlingen South last week.

East is in the playoffs if it beats Brownsville Hanna on Friday.

Los Fresnos climbed two spots to No. 7 after beating Brownsville Rivera 27-7 to improve to 5-4. The Falcons host Weslaco High on Friday night and are in the playoffs if they win.

The aforementioned Weslaco High Panthers are No. 8. At 5-4, Weslaco High fell to San Benito last week and now must beat Los Fresnos on Friday if it wants to play beyond Week 11.

Edcouch-Elsa returns to the poll at No. 9 after its 33-6 romp over former top-10 team Brownsville Lopez. The Yellowjackets clinched a playoff spot with the win and visit winless Brownsville Porter this week.

Brownsville Veterans Memorial rounded out the poll at No. 10. The playoff-bound Chargers are 7-2 and have won four straight games. They visit Donna High this week and can clinch at least a share of the District 32-5A title with a win.

Four other teams received votes in this week’s poll. They were Port Isabel, Mercedes, Rio Hondo and Sharyland High.

WEEK 11 RGVSPORTS.COM TOP 10 POLL

The following are the teams in RGVSports.com’s Top 10 poll, with first-place votes in parentheses and total points based on 10 points for a first-place vote through 1 point for a 10th-place vote. The seven voters are writers who cover RGV high school football for AIM Media’s three newspapers (the Monitor, Valley Morning Star and Brownsville Herald).

Team – Record – Points – Prev.

1. San Benito (7) 9-0 70 1

2. Harlingen High 7-2 62 2

3. Edinburg Vela 8-1 53 3

4. McAllen Memorial 7-2 48 4

5. Sharyland Pioneer 7-2 40 6

6. Weslaco East 5-4 30 8

7. Los Fresnos 5-4 29 9

8. Weslaco High 5-4 20 5

9. Edcouch-Elsa 6-3 10 NR

10. Brownsville Veterans Memorial 7-2 9 NR

Other teams receiving votes: Port Isabel (6), Mercedes (4), Rio Hondo (2), Sharyland High (1).
